One feature I found particularly clever is the specific traction engraving mechanism. The engraving wheel has a diameter of 12 mm, and what’s great is that this wheel is always visible from the operator’s side. This transparency gives me full control over the cutting process, ensuring I can make precise adjustments on the fly. It’s these little details that make a big difference in professional or DIY tile cutting tasks, where accuracy is everything.

Another aspect that stands out is the CNC milled wheel holder excavation combined with an anti-friction metal shell. This design effectively eliminates friction and lateral wear on the engraving wheel, which means the tool will maintain its cutting precision longer without frequent replacements or adjustments. For me, this translates to less downtime and lower maintenance costs, making the Tile cutter Art. 4DU a smart investment over time.

The roller carriage system also impressed me. It is wear-free due to the inclusion of 3 double-row ball bearings. These bearings ensure the carriage moves smoothly and precisely, which is vital for clean, straight cuts. The maintenance-free nature of this component adds to the tool’s overall durability and reliability, which is exactly what I want from a quality tile cutter. Knowing that the carriage won’t degrade quickly means I can rely on consistent performance from the tool.

The inclusion of the Magnetic Mosaic mat 64B2 NEX Series 4 is an excellent addition. Mosaic tiles, due to their small size and numerous pieces, can be tricky to handle and cut cleanly. The magnetic mat helps keep the tiles firmly in place, minimizing movement and allowing for more precise cuts. I find this especially helpful when working on delicate or intricate mosaic patterns, as it reduces the risk of breakage or misalignment. Key Features to Consider

From my experience, some features stood out as essential when choosing a Sigma Tile Cutter 48 Inch. First, the length of the cutter rail needs to be sturdy and straight to ensure accurate cuts. I also paid attention to the scoring wheel quality, as a sharp, durable wheel makes the cutting smoother and extends the tool’s lifespan. The handle mechanism should be comfortable and provide enough leverage to snap tiles cleanly without excessive effort.

Material and Build Quality

I found that the material used in the cutter’s construction greatly affects durability. A robust metal frame is preferable to plastic parts, as it withstands heavy use and keeps the alignment precise. The base should be stable and sometimes have rubber feet to prevent slipping during operation. This stability was crucial for me to avoid errors while cutting.

Ease of Use and Comfort

Using the cutter should feel natural and not cause fatigue. I looked for ergonomic handles and smooth sliding rails. Some models offer adjustable guides or measuring systems, which I found very helpful to reduce measurement errors and speed up my workflow. The ease of changing scoring wheels also mattered to me for maintenance purposes.
